We are fortunate in York to be reasonably close to several very attractive areas of countryside - the Yorkshire Dales to the west, the North York Moors to the north-east, and the Yorkshire Wolds to the east.
Here is a shot from the Wolds Way long distance footpath west of the village of Thixendale, where several deep valleys converge.
The Yorkshire Wolds are made of chalk, and the valleys were created at the end of the ice age when there was much more water in the area than there is now. Many of these valleys are now completely dry.
The valleys are often used as pasture land for sheep or cattle, while the flat tops of the hills are used for a variety of crops.
Farms tend to be large, while the villages are small, often with very few facilities, but usually quite attractive.
The walk that I did was a figure of eight route some 8 miles long, with lovely views across the open landscapes of the hilltops, but with several deep valleys to cross. As you can see, the weather was ideal for such an excursion.
